31/**
32 * RsaKeymaster1KeyFactory is a KeyFactory that creates and loads keys which are actually backed by
33 * a hardware keymaster1 module, but which does not support all keymaster1 digests.  If unsupported
34 * digests are found during generation or import, KM_DIGEST_NONE is added to the key description,
35 * then the operations handle the unsupported digests in software.
36 *
37 * If unsupported digests are requested and KM_PAD_RSA_PSS or KM_PAD_RSA_OAEP is also requested, but
38 * KM_PAD_NONE is not present KM_PAD_NONE will be added to the description, to allow for
39 * software padding as well as software digesting.
40 */
41class RsaKeymaster1KeyFactory : public RsaKeyFactory {
42  public:
43    RsaKeymaster1KeyFactory(const SoftKeymasterContext* context, const Keymaster1Engine* engine);
44
45    keymaster_error_t GenerateKey(const AuthorizationSet& key_description,
46                                  KeymasterKeyBlob* key_blob, AuthorizationSet* hw_enforced,
47                                  AuthorizationSet* sw_enforced) const override;
48
49    keymaster_error_t ImportKey(const AuthorizationSet& key_description,
50                                keymaster_key_format_t input_key_material_format,
51                                const KeymasterKeyBlob& input_key_material,
52                                KeymasterKeyBlob* output_key_blob, AuthorizationSet* hw_enforced,
53                                AuthorizationSet* sw_enforced) const override;
54
55    keymaster_error_t LoadKey(const KeymasterKeyBlob& key_material,
56                              const AuthorizationSet& additional_params,
57                              const AuthorizationSet& hw_enforced,
58                              const AuthorizationSet& sw_enforced,
59                              UniquePtr<Key>* key) const override;
60
61    OperationFactory* GetOperationFactory(keymaster_purpose_t purpose) const override;
62
63  private:
64    const Keymaster1Engine* engine_;
65
66    std::unique_ptr<OperationFactory> sign_factory_;
67    std::unique_ptr<OperationFactory> decrypt_factory_;
68    std::unique_ptr<OperationFactory> verify_factory_;
69    std::unique_ptr<OperationFactory> encrypt_factory_;
70};
